39 C.F.R. § 3010.165 — Motions for reconsideration.

§ 3010.165 Motions for reconsideration. (a) Any person may file a motion requesting reconsideration of a final order by the Commission. (b) The motion shall be filed within 15 days of the issuance of the final order that is the subject of the motion and must: (1) Briefly and specifically allege material errors of fact or law and the relief sought; and (2) Be confined to new questions raised by the determination or action ordered and upon which the moving party had no prior opportunity to submit arguments. (c) Upon filing a motion for reconsideration, the underlying Commission order is not deemed to be final for purposes of 39 U.S.C. 3663 until final disposition of the motion. [87 FR 43214, July 20, 2022]
